What you will be doing! As a Telecommunications Network Engineer 0, your primary role will be to maintain and sustain existing networks while identifying and resolving issues. Requirements: Resolve routine network problems; operate network analyzers, WAN test equipment, and network simulators Monitors data or voice system networks for various messages, alarms, or issues. Activates scripts as alarms occur or issues surface. Confirms accuracy of messages, alarms or issues and/or determines severity of problem, issue or alarm. Initiates resolution as appropriate. Troubleshoots problems using scripts and standard, routine procedures; escalates as appropriate. Researches issues to determine if problem may be resolved using predefined procedures. Resolves basic issues; documents the results. Communicates occurrence of alarms or issues and resulting actions taken to resolve or escalate problem. Executes scheduled maintenance routines in accordance with standard procedures. Identifies issues or problems and resolves as appropriate; escalates when necessary Activates/deactivates network lines according to established schedules. Performs first- and/or second-level problem determination (first level is help desk). Interfaces with users and/or network vendors. Can follow detailed work instructions. Education and Experience: Two(2) years of experience in programs and contracts of similar scope, type, and complexity are required. An associate's degree in engineering technology from an accredited college is also required. Two (2) years of additional network engineering experience may be substituted for an Associate's degree. An IAT level II baseline certification as defined by DoD 8570.01-M is required. Experience with installation and configuration of any levels of network devices, such as firewalls, switches, routers, cabling, Cisco, Brocade, or Juniper devices is a plus.
